description |
The growing complexity of global challenges that advocate human values necessitates a shift towards future oriented, human-centric design approaches. Such thinking is embedded in a foresight-driven coursework, part of the Bachelor of Information Technology (Hons) offered in Universiti Teknologi MARA. It trains students to anticipate future trends and co-create innovative, resilient and sustainable solutions. In this paper we elaborate how foresight methodology, when integrated with participatory design approach, can result in powerful human-centric solutions that are future-proof. Through future tools such as horizon scanning, the seven questions technique, issues paper, driver mapping, futures wheel, SWOT analysis, prototyping and road mapping, students engage with stakeholder to address present and future challenges, equipping them to design adaptable, human-centric technological solutions. © 2024 IEEE. |
